Heavy Metal Eruption is a compilation album that gathers ten Italian heavy metal bands and was curated by journalist Beppe Riva. It is considered a historic document of 1980s Italian metal; only 1000 copies were printed.

Curated by journalist Beppe Riva (associated with the magazines Rockerilla and Hard'N'Heavy). The compilation gathers ten young Italian metal bands and tracks: Halloween ("Vikings"), Crying Steel ("Thundergods"), Death SS ("Black And Violet"), Strana Officina ("Non Sei Normale"), Rollerball ("Wild Town"), Steel Crown ("Prisoners In The Box"), Elektradrive ("Lord Of The Ring"), Revenge ("Angels In Leather"), Shining Blade ("Freakish Footsteps"), and Ransackers ("Death Line"). Only 1000 copies were printed, making it sought after by collectors. The compilation is described as a true historical document of eighties Italian metal.
